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92106 93344250 7163 6027753
3798 2493907668 033143
3798 2493907668 033143
106554370 786116 925608 769453807 66142759
All about undefined
Interested in learning more?
3798 2493907668 033143
106554370 786116 925608 769453807 66142759
See more
7615475309 806 2100009
0036 6013741115 0537
See more
803 50274781220
0074 921288452 89406
See more